Study findings from L. Bordier et al broaden understanding of diabetes

Published in Surgery Litigation and Law Weekly, April 18th, 2008

New research, 'What is the role of computed tomographic coronary angiography in diabetic patients,' is the subject of a report. According to recent research from Saint-Mande, France, "All diabetes specialists are aware of the frequency and severity of coronary disease in diabetics. Non-invasive diagnostic tests perform well, but they could be better."

"To assess the role of computed tomographic coronary angiography in diabetics. New cardiac imaging techniques such as CT coronary angiography are promising tools for the selection of patients for conventional X-ray coronary angiography, which remains the key for diagnosis and angioplasty.
